St. Mark’s Free Community Dinner for May

May 9, 2023 By Marcellus News Leave a Comment

St. Mark’s Free Dinner will be from 5:30-6:30pm, Thursday May 18, 2023.  The church is located at 412 Cedar Street, Paw Paw.  The meal will consist of ham and au gratin potatoes, cole slaw and dessert.  All in the community are welcome.  … [Read more...] about St. Mark’s Free Community Dinner for May
